Output eacbc0df140e71189a49ef36b372b6db00973a010c88282a9ab41493430b6bb9:0

value
401571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0784659c55c2c69a584471d01401e9c3a1dd2e4f OP_EQUAL
address
32NmFz7rThCq85CUHByFX3fxx73xgqkH9i
transaction
eacbc0df140e71189a49ef36b372b6db00973a010c88282a9ab41493430b6bb9
confirmations
102821
spent
true